About Bedford Electronic Organ Society

In the Beginning...

Bedford Electronic Organ Society was formed by Les Franklin in 1972 but not under the name as we know it today. It started as The Hammond Organ Society and met once a month at The Mr Music shop in Bromham Road, Bedford. It wasn't long before the Social Club of the C.E.G. Board in Barkers Lane, Bedford became their second venue and was run similar to the format of today but that wasn't the last move. In 1976 the club moved across town to Kempston Transfiguration Church Hall for monthly meetings and by combining the use of the Addison Centre, also in Kempston, a large community centre with a seating capacity of 298 with stage, it was now possible to promote professional organists for six months of the year for members and the general public.

Membership increased steadily at the monthly meetings and the need was still to find a larger venue. In January 1998 the club moved once more to where it is today, Kempston Town Councils New Centenary Hall on the Bedford Road, behind the Council Offices in Kempston and has a seating capacity of 160.

Today...

We find there is still a good following of people who like to listen to electronic organ music but not so many taking up playing. So our format has changed slightly to accommodate this need.  We have an Annual Coach trip to a first class venue which includes a meal afterwards in a restaurant. We also hold an extremely popular Dinner and Dance at Christmas for members and guests.

Concert nights at the Addison Centre have increased to 7 a year with the first of the season donating all proceeds to the Addison Centre Hall funds as the management are not helped in any way by the local council.

The club produces 12 newsletters a year where members are informed of forthcoming concerts in and around the Beds, Bucks and Northants areas.  It also gives the facility for advertising and keeps members enlightened of general information concerned with the club.
